As microbial fermentation technologies continue to advance in the biotechnology, pharmaceutical, food, and industrial sectors, selecting an efficient and stable culture medium component has become increasingly important. Among various nitrogen sources, yeast extract is widely recognized as one of the most effective nutritional ingredients for supporting microbial and cell growth.

Derived from Saccharomyces cerevisiae, yeast extract provides a balanced composition of amino acids, peptides, nucleotides, vitamins, and trace nutrients, making it suitable for a broad range of fermentation applications.

Complete Nutritional Profile

Yeast extract naturally contains a comprehensive range of nutrients required for microbial metabolism, including:

  • 18 amino acids
  • Small peptides
  • Nucleotides
  • B-complex vitamins
  • Organic nitrogen compounds

These nutrients provide microorganisms with a readily available nutrient source, reducing the need for additional supplementation while promoting rapid and healthy cell growth.

Rich Organic Nitrogen Source

Organic nitrogen plays a critical role in fermentation performance. Our yeast extract provides more than 10% available nitrogen, making it an ideal nitrogen source for bacterial, yeast, fungal, and cell culture media.

Compared with traditional protein hydrolysates, yeast extract offers higher bioavailability and better nutrient balance.

Excellent Water Solubility

The product is 100% water soluble, allowing rapid dissolution during media preparation without precipitation. This improves process efficiency and ensures uniform nutrient distribution throughout the fermentation system.

Faster Microbial Growth

The naturally occurring low-molecular-weight peptides and amino acids can be directly utilized by microorganisms without extensive enzymatic degradation, improving overall production efficiency.
